源码的版本控制

源码的源码版本控制

在软件开发过程中,源码的本控版本控制是一个非常重要的环节。它通过记录和管理软件文件的源码变更历史,确保团队成员可以高效协作,本控同时也可以方便地回溯到特定版本,源码以修复bug或还原功能。本控

版本控制的源码重要性

在开发过程中,可能会出现多人同时修改同一个文件、本控误删文件、源码遇到bug等情况。本控如果没有版本控制,源码这些问题将会给项目带来不可估量的本控风险。

常见的源码版本控制系统

目前,最常见的本控版本控制系统有Git、SVN等。源码Git是一个分布式版本控制系统,具有分支管理、团队协作等强大功能。SVN是集中式版本控制系统,相对Git而言较为简单。

Git的基本操作

Git的基本操作包括:
1. 初始化一个仓库:git init
2. 添加文件到暂存区:git add
3. 提交文件到仓库:git commit
4. 创建分支:git branch
5. 切换分支:git checkout
6. 合并分支:git merge
7. 查看提交日志:git log

版本控制的最佳实践

为了更好地管理源码的版本控制,团队应遵循以下最佳实践:
1. 确定合适的分支策略,如主干分支、开发分支、发布分支等;
2. 每次提交都应有明确的提交信息,便于他人和未来自己理解;
3. 避免直接在主分支上进行修改,应使用分支管理功能;
4. 频繁地进行代码审查,确保代码质量;
5. 定期备份仓库,防止意外丢失数据。

如何选择版本控制系统

在选择版本控制系统时,可以根据团队规模、项目需求、技术栈等因素进行考虑。如果团队成员熟悉Git且项目需要复杂的分支管理,可以选择Git。如果团队规模较小且项目相对简单,可以选择SVN。

结语

源码的版本控制是软件开发过程中不可或缺的一环,它可以帮助团队高效协作、提高代码质量、确保项目稳定性。通过选择合适的版本控制系统和遵循最佳实践,团队可以更好地管理源码的变更历史,实现项目的成功交付。

更多内容请点击【百科】专栏

精彩资讯